| RRP In the 1990s the small West African countries of Angola and Sierra Leone disintegrated into bloodbaths of torture murder and civil war. The carnage was fueled by the illicit trade of gems that adorn the fingers of millions of people around the world. The vast sums of money and weapons exchanged in return for diamonds have helped fund some of the bloodiest civil wars in Africa and led to human rights atrocities committed against civilians. For this reason the stones have become known as blood diamonds or conflict diamonds. This hard-hitting DVD looks at the story behind the glamorous image of diamonds. | RRP Eva Braun became the mistress of Adolf Hitler in 1932. She remained at his side until the pair committed suicide on April 30th 1945 having married the previous day. In the years between Eva Braun captured the secret life of Adolf Hitler on film. She shot over 4 hours of extraordinary and revealing 'home movie footage' much of it in colour on a 16mm camera. She also took over 4 000 still photographs. Much of this material has never been made available before and provides a unique close up look at the world of the Nazi leader and his high command. Also close to the Fuhrer was the mysterious Heinrich Hoffmann Hitler's official photographer who took some of the most remarkable images of Nazi Germany ever committed to film. Using these stunning film materials from Eva Braun and Heinrich Hoffmann together with the diaries of Braun and Goebbels and personal letters this unique DVD reveals the chilling and sinister world of Hitler and his regime as never before - as recorded by those who were At Hitler's Side.

| RRP With the Peninsular War still raging Napoleon made a fateful decision in 1812 when he turned his attentions east and the Grand Army began an invasion of Russia. Nothing could have prepared them for what lay ahead as they marched slowly towards Moscow. Little did they know that of the half a million men who crossed the Russian border fewer than fifty thousand would ever see their homeland again. This episode tells the story of Napoleon's greatest mistake - his ill-fated Russian adventure that spelt the beginning of the end for the Emperor. The episode includes the story of the bloody Battle of Borodino and the appalling horrors of the French retreat from Moscow.

| RRP The U-505 is a German World War 2 Type-IXc submarine that was captured in battle on the high seas by boarding parties from the USS Guadalcanal task group 22.3 on 4 June 1944. This film contains some of the most amazing war footage ever taken documenting the capture in detail.
